Api 653 Tank Inspector
2 weeks ago
**Responsibilities**:
Streamline Inspection Ltd. is looking for certified API 653 Inspectors. We are currently looking for applicants based in Alberta with the ability to travel to and from various sites to perform inspections throughout Canada.
Preference will be given to those based in the Calgary, Edmonton, or Red Deer areas.
**STREAMLINE INSPECTION OFFERS**:
- Competitive wages
- RRSP Program with company match
- Company paid health and dental coverage
- Training Program to support your career path
**RESPONSIBILITIES**:
- Perform API 653 inspections, assessing inspection results, reporting all findings, and recommending any required repairs.
- Act as a crew lead and manage and mentor a crew of NDT technicians and assistants who will support all inspection activities.
- Establish and maintain positive working relationships with both clients and co-workers.
- Coordinate all on-site schedule logistics and contractor management.
- Observe and follow safety rules and practices, and other safety requirements for all projects.
**RE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S**:
- Proven ability to lead field inspections, manage deliverables, and balance multiple projects.
- Technical writing and field inspection reporting skills.
- Proficiency with Microsoft Suite.
- Current certifications in First Aid, H2S Alive, Confined Space Entry/Rescue, Fall Protection, Common Safety Orientation.
- Valid Class 5 driver’s license with a clean abstract.
- Ability to perform physically demanding activities that may involve moving, setting up, and operating inspection equipment
**ASSETS**:
- NDE certifications including Ultrasonic Testing (UT), Magnetic Particle Testing (MT), and Liquid Penetrant Inspection (LPI).
- Experience in: Magnetic Flux Leakage (MFL) technology, large storage tank inspections up to 300′ in diameter, CCME inspections.
- Minimum of 3 years’ experience performing aboveground tank inspections.
